Call of Duty: Warzone 2.0 is Now Available

Call of Duty: Warzone 2.0 is now available on PC, Xbox, and PlayStation consoles. This is a new version of the Call of Duty battle royale experience with a new map, game modes, and other gameplay changes compared to the original Warzone game, which will continue to exist.

The new Warzone 2.0 map, Al Mazrah, mixes rural outskirts with a metropolitan area. Players will find new vehicles including an armored patrol boat. Warzone 2.0 introduces new aquatic combat capabilities, though be aware that you can only use select weapons and other tactical equipment underwater.

On the ground, you can now knock off the doors of vehicles and blow out their tires as well. All vehicles now consume fuel that you can refill at gas stations, and you can also repair tire damage there.

The Gulag experience that players encounter upon first death has also been revamped in Warzone 2.0: It’s now a 2v2 fight and players will be randomly paired with each other. The Overtime mechanism introduces a new heavily-armed Jailer in the middle of the map, and eliminating him will send all four players back to the match.

In addition to the classic Battle Royale experience, players will discover a new DMZ mode where they can complete faction-based missions and earn loot to use in the next match. The optional contracts available in the Battle Royale mode are also included in DMZ, in addition to new Strongholds filled with AI enemies.

Call of Duty: Warzone 2.0 still supports cross-play multiplayer on Xbox, PlayStation, and PC, and owners of Call of Duty: Modern Warfare II can enjoy some bonus content and XP in the game. As mentioned earlier, the original Warzone game will live on and be rebranded to “Warzone Caldera” later this year.
